Transaction 7fcd93b96174ada2f3a6a9ba1333f832433db6e8b28d586f3e7b34ba84f3c9b3
1 Input
2 Outputs
- 7fcd93b96174ada2f3a6a9ba1333f832433db6e8b28d586f3e7b34ba84f3c9b3:0
- 7fcd93b96174ada2f3a6a9ba1333f832433db6e8b28d586f3e7b34ba84f3c9b3:1
value 19268062
address 18yrkTuN462TVdwy1ThyEK4GUL7doKwfnT
value 514657692
address 3H1v8y7xbVxV1464C2TYxDSV427J641g8m